How they compare
Sweden currently reports 3 against 2 in Czechia, a difference of 1.
That makes Sweden's figure about 1.5 times Czechia's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 21 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Sweden ahead.
Czechia ranks 28th and Sweden ranks 25th of 103 countries.
Sweden has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
